COMMENCEMENT OF UNRESTRICTIVE BURNING TIME


Pursuant to Section 18 of the Bushfires Act 1954, the Shire of Gnowangerup would like to advise Landowner/Occupiers that Unrestrictive Burning Time (Open Burning) will commence as of Friday 23 April 2021.


Landowner/Occupiers are to proceed with caution when burning and to be mindful of the following
conditions;
• Maintain 3 metre Bare Earth Fire Break around burn area.
• Have appropriate firefighting resources near-by.
• Check weather conditions (current and incoming) prior to ignition.
• Nuisance smoke affecting neighbours or impacting road networks.
• If burning heaps, please maintain watch of heaps until fully extinguished.
• Pursuant to Section 46 Bush Fires Act; Fire Control Officers can suspend/postpone burning at any time, should unfavourable weather conditions pass through the district or if they deem the fire to be unsafe.


The Shire of Gnowangerup will consider pursuing compensation of cost against the Landowner/Occupier (permissible under the Bush Fires Act) should any fires escape due to neglect.
